Commercial real estate financing is funding secured by commercial property. It covers acquisitions, refinances, and value-add projects across asset classes such as office, retail, industrial, warehouse, hospitality, and multifamily. Underwriting weighs the property's income, the borrower's profile, and the asset's location and condition.
